"Tucked away on a residential tree-lined section of Greenwood Avenue, Gorgeous George’s seasonal menu is filled with surprises like spring lamb ribs and Mediterranean pairings with local seafood. Although the restaurant is praised for its warm and relaxing, romantic ambiance, it’s best to call ahead to make sure that the dining area is open, as it transitioned to mostly offering takeout during the pandemic." - Sabra Boyd

Ate at Gorgeous George eons ago when it first opened and definitely pre Yelp. I remember the welcoming warmth of the chef/owner. He was also wearing an actual toque. I drive past this restaurant often as I like the North Seattle Broadview-Greenwood-Phinney Ridge corridor. It is small, but often full. Finally, I returned for mostly a solo dinner on 12/6/17. Traffic and street parking were a test in patience, but got a corner 2 top by the windows. (Sit elsewhere during winter or dress in layers) My dining companion was severely delayed, so I decided to proceed with my order. The water served was interesting a variety of citrus, pineapple, and mint. I had a cup of the lentil soup, followed by the Shish Tawouk platter ($20, grilled chicken, veg, rice, garlic and tzaziki sauces). Flavorful, but the iteration from Petra in Belltown has a edge slight for me. For dessert I opted on the Tiramisu topped with pistachios ($8) and an espresso shot ($3.25). These were suitable alternates since that evening there was no baklava or the ability to make a mocha. By then, my former pastry school classmate showed up. We chatted and shared dessert while he awaited his takeout order. A neighboring table were clearly regulars. Suddenly, the background music switched to a celebratory tune where a dessert with candle was brought out to their table. The chef also appeared dancing with a balanced wine bottle on his head. Wow, that was totally unexpected! Here's are reason why a smallish neighborhood spot like Gorgeous George has lasted for years...consistent service, tasty cuisine, and welcoming atmosphere.
